Why is endowment a high priority in the campaign?
Endowment is the gift which gives forever. The principal remains intact while the earned income is used to provide student scholarships and programs, faculty/staff support, and project and program funding. Endowment funds make up a significant portion of the budget for many private universities and colleges, and they are often roughly equivalent to state appropriations of public institutions. Increasingly, public universities also have large, growing endowments that can help to close the gap between declining state appropriations and growing needs and aspirations. The average endowment per student at Sam Houston State University is about $1,600. A look at the top public and private universities reveals that the average endowment per student at public universities is $24,000 and $469,000 at private universities.
